Job description

Location: Hybrid (in-office days - Tuesday, Wednesday, and Thursday)

Department: Accounting

Reports to: Controller

Exemption Status: Nonexempt

Job Summary:

The Accounting Administrator Specialist provides essential accounting and administrative support to the Accounting Department and works closely with department leadership. This role requires a strong foundation in accounting, attention to detail, and the ability to manage multiple priorities while balancing transactional accounting responsibilities with departmental support functions.

Primary responsibilities include accounts payable processing, cash reconciliations, maintenance of financial records, and support of routine accounting activities to ensure accurate, timely, and compliant financial operations. The role also provides administrative support for finance-related committees and meetings, including the coordination of materials and the preparation of meeting minutes.

This position plays a key role in strengthening internal controls, supporting monthly close processes, and ensuring the smooth and efficient operation of the accounting function.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Supports full-cycle accounts payable processing, including invoice review, vendor maintenance, reconciliations, 1099 reporting, honoraria payments for 400+ appointees, and ensuring proper coding and compliance with internal policies.
  • Support and processes travel and meeting-related expense processing, including reimbursement review, reconciliation of airline and hotel invoices, assignment of general ledger codes, and calculation of applicable sales tax refunds.
  • Performs daily cash activity processing, including preparation of deposit journal entries and reconciliation of bank activity to the internal CMS enrollment system, researching and resolving discrepancies.
  • Prepares monthly bank reconciliations for multiple entities and accounts, investigating outstanding items and ensuring alignment between bank statements and the general ledger.
  • Supports monthly close activities by reconciling assigned general ledger accounts, preparing routine journal entries, and assisting with sales and use tax filings.
  • Serves as back-up in reviewing staff timesheets for accuracy and appropriate program allocation prior to processing.
  • Provides administrative support to department leadership, including coordinating and scheduling finance-related meetings, assembling committee materials, preparing clear and accurate meeting minutes, and managing departmental documentation and travel reporting.
